Che Madeline Moore Obituary

Obituary published on Legacy.com by Uht Funeral Home and Cremation Services on Nov. 6, 2023.
Che Che Moore (Jarjosa) passed away on November 2, 2023 at the age of 84 in Plymouth, Michigan. She was born on January 23, 1939 in Detroit, Michigan to the late Josephine Jarjosa. Che Che was the beloved mother of David (Mary) Moore, Shannon (Ron) Dobreff, and Shellie Moore. Loving grandmother of Jackie (Jon) Owens, Kaley (Justin) Gauvin, Savannah Dobreff, Connor Moore, and Kyle Moore. Adored great grandmother of Otto Owens and Nova Owens. Sister of George (Penni) Jarjosa, Joe (Renee/Paula) Jarjosa, and the late Wanda Starr.
Che Che loved her family and many friends. When her kids were young, she was an active Hockey, Soccer, and Figure skating mom. Whether it was practices, games, or shows she was always in the stands encouraging and cheering them on. She was also active in school activities, and still proudly displayed some of the art projects that were made for her during the grade school years.
As an avid music lover there was always music being played in the house and in the car. She enjoyed going to concerts with her friends and attended well over 100 shows over the years. Her kids also experienced their first concerts with mom as well!
More recently she enjoyed spending time with her grandchildren. She embraced being the most valuable baby-sitter, going to birthday parties, attending school events, and hosting sleepovers. When it came to their sporting events, she was their number one fan.
Che Che was very passionate about the holiday season. Her Christmas trees and decorations were festive and beautiful. She enjoyed sharing her homemade eggnog and other various treats she would prepare. She also loved watching the classic holiday programs with her family every year. Her kind heart and loving nature will be deeply missed.
